“There were many reasons for such a decline, including weaker economic growth abroad, stricter capital controls in China, a stronger U.S. dollar and a low home supply”, – noted Lawrence Yun, NAR chief economist. “Nevertheless, it’s the level of decrease that worries us, pointing to weaker confidence in owning a home in the U.S.”
Canadians tend to be cash buyers (76%). Florida was still the most popular destination for Canadian buyers who spend more time south of the border.
“Many Canadians and other foreign buyers choose Florida due to its flexible tax laws,” – said Yun. “Moreover, many Florida areas have a large supply of relatively affordable houses, which makes this region highly attractive”.
California and Texas are also among popular destinations with 12% and 10% of international purchases made here, respectively. Then goes Arizona with a 5% share of international sales.
